IPACM: reduce the prints in QXDM
In order to share QXDM with other modules in Apps, IPACM needs to reduce the message prints in QXDM to avoid flooding the log. With this change, IPACM will only print important msg to QXDM and for the complete IPACM log, user needs to run manually to get. Change-Id: Ib768dd3f3a7933dd4b57a6dd866becadf0bea126
